From Crafers to Port Willunga by bus and train
To get from Crafers to Port Willunga in Adelaide,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one train line: take the 863 bus from Stop 24 Crafers Ramp - South side station to Stop W2 Currie St - South side station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the SEAFRD train and finally take the 750 bus from Zone A Seaford Interchange station to Stop 113 Quinliven Rd - North side station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 7 min.
